DDT is actually used in Disease Vector Control (i.e. IRS)
| Yes1 |
Reported DDT use in:
2001: 7.426 kg;
2002: 6.375 kg;
2003:
13.067 kg.1
GEF-funded NIP Project descriptions are currently not available on the GEF website.3
The amount of DDT that can be applied at any season depends on the occurrence of epidemics and can be between 7.000 - 30.000 kg.5
Reported DDT use in:
1998: 5.141 kg a.i.;
1999: 25.283 kg a.i.;
2000: 3.034 kg a.i.;
2001: 6.272 kg a.i.;
2002: 6.375 kg a.i.6

DDT is imported
| Yes1 |
DDT imported from China. In 2003: 28.087 kg.1 |

Hold usable stocks of DDT
| Yes1 |
In 2001, the total stock of DDT was 21.667,5 kg, in 2002: 14.445 kg
and in 2003: 22.500 kg.1
FAO reports that 24.245 litres of obsolete DDT stockpiles have been identified in the country.5
